Where To Buy Credit Card Gift Cards -
: Some banks sell Visa gift cards directly to their customers, often with lower activation fees or enhanced security features (1.1.4, 1.4.4). Where to Buy Online
Credit card gift cards—commonly known as "open-loop" cards because they can be used almost anywhere—are widely available through both physical retailers and secure online platforms. These cards, typically issued by Visa (1.3.7, 1.5.4), Mastercard (1.2.9), and American Express , serve as versatile gifts or convenient tools for online shopping without a traditional bank account (1.2.2, 1.4.1). Where to Buy In-Store where to buy credit card gift cards
When purchasing these cards, it is essential to remain vigilant against fraud. For in-store purchases, experts at Gift Card Granny suggest inspecting the packaging for signs of tampering, such as peeled stickers or scratched-off PIN covers (1.5.3, 1.5.9). Online, always verify that the site uses a secure "https" connection (1.5.8). : Some banks sell Visa gift cards directly
Additionally, be prepared for one-time activation fees, which typically range from depending on the card's value (1.2.2, 1.4.4). Unlike store-specific cards, these funds never expire, though some may incur inactivity fees if left unused for over a year (1.2.2, 1.5.2). Where to Buy In-Store When purchasing these cards,
: Websites like Giftcards.com (1.1.1, 1.3.6) and Gift Card Granny (1.2.4, 1.5.9) are highly rated for their customization options and bulk purchase capabilities (1.1.2, 1.3.4).
: Stores like Walmart (1.1.7, 1.4.1) and Target (1.4.3, 1.5.8) stock a wide variety of denominations.
: Large supermarkets such as Kroger (1.4.2, 1.4.8) often provide the added benefit of earning loyalty rewards, like fuel points, on gift card purchases (1.2.5).